Character of the water

Rötjärnen lies in the cold north — a northern clear oligotrophic forest lake. The water is crystal-clear and the fish skittish in the sharp light.

The surroundings

The lake lies remote, ringed by forest and bog far from any road. Few find their way here — the water is untouched and the stock undisturbed.

Moderately deep (6 m) — shallow bays, the odd reef and a deeper channel through the middle.

Permits & rules

Fishing permit required — Rötjärnen FVOF. Day permit ~160 kr · annual permit ~800 kr.

  •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
  • Trout & Arctic char: protected during the autumn spawn · catch-and-release on certain stretches.
  •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.
